Мне нужно подключиться к SSH-серверу в моем рабочем офисе из академической сети, но при всех попытках возникает "Ошибка тайм-аута". У меня дома и в других местах доступ работает нормально (SSH-сервер работает отлично!).
Я попытался получить доступ к публичному SSH-серверу через порт 22, но снова произошел тайм-аут.
Эта академическая сеть не имеет прокси, я могу использовать свой ноутбук для доступа ко всему в Интернете. Некоторые попытки:
ssh username@targetip -p port
ssh -R remoteIP:remoteport:localIP:localport hostname
ssh -C2qTnN -D 9090 username@targetip -p port
Но ничего!
Есть идеи? Я попробую OpenVPN, но я не хочу настраивать и использовать VPN все время.
Спасибо
решение1
Попросите [провайдера] открыть [порт 22]
Я не думаю, что это произойдет по соображениям безопасности. Запустите sshd
на своем сервере прослушивание порта 443 и используйте proxytunnel
или nc
как ProxyCommand
в вашем ~/.ssh/config
, чтобы пересечь исходящий http-прокси вашей академической сети.